要約(日本語): Development of a high performance flexible and large-scale tactile sensor and actuator has been one of the important subjects for robotics and IoT technology, recently. For this purpose, we have examined to develop a thin film material of polymer electrets with high piezoelectric properties. The film was prepared by using electrospinning technique. The quality of the thin film and its piezoelectric properties were dependent on the film deposition condition. By using this unique polymer thin film, high-performance tactile sensors and actuators was examined to be developed.
